Why Choose BSI Flex 1888 v2.0:2025-03?
As the automotive industry transitions towards greater automation, the need for robust standards becomes increasingly critical. The BSI Flex 1888 v2.0:2025-03 standard is designed to address the unique challenges posed by automated vehicles. It offers a structured approach to identifying, assessing, and mitigating risks associated with minimal risk events (MRX), which are scenarios where a vehicle must transition to a minimal risk condition due to system failures or external factors.
